The race to succeed Tergat at NOC-K heats up

NOC-K President Paul Tergat waves during the medal ceremony for the women's 10,000m athletics event during the 2022 Commonwealth Games at the Alexander Stadium, in Birmingham. [Kelly Ayodi, Standard]

The race to succeed Paul Tergat as the President of the National Olympic Committee of Kenya (NOC-K) is gaining momentum ahead of the upcoming elections slated for April 24, 2025.
